A reward for the Cohen family
By Israel Harel
...Edited...
In the lovely house of Rabbi Ophir Cohen and his wife Noga, everything is in its place. The glass covering the huge bookshelf shines, like it was polished for the Sabbath. Their eight children are calm and behave as they do every Sabbath. There is no denial, but there is faith. And around the Sabbath table they don't protest when the possibility is raised that their efforts won't succeed. They will welcome the evacuators, says Noga, as one welcomes brothers.
On the 11th day of the Jewish month of Heshvan 5761, November 20, 2000, a powerful explosive detonated near a bus carrying children to the local schools. Two adults - Miri Amitai and Gabi Biton - were killed on the spot. Three children from the Cohen family were seriously wounded. Intelligence sources in the army tied Mohammed Dahlan to the incident. Ariel Sharon, then in opposition (in Ehud Barak's government), demanded that Dahlan be killed. Now Sharon is (via the defense minister) conducting "coordinating talks" with Dahlan, a Palestinian minister.
The terror attack stunned the country. Tens of thousands of people recited Psalms to save the Cohen children, at the request of their parents: Orit lost her right foot, Yisrael lost his right leg below the knee, and Tehila ended up losing both her legs. After nearly two years of rehabilitation, in the course of which the children and the parents discovered overwhelming strength, the Cohen family returned to its home in Kfar Darom.
And now, surely as a show of gratitude for the family's bravery and persistence in returning to the place where the children were hurt and which remains dangerous, the government of Israel decided to present the family with the highest reward for bravery that a normal country - which appreciates largeness of spirit and courage - can give to its best, most loyal and most modest citizens: evacuation from home, community and land.
